What are the Pros of Using Marketplace in Healthcare

Marketplace in healthcare benefits both patients and providers. Patients now have the power to choose their healthcare solutions and providers are motivated to provide the best in class healthcare experiences. 

Increased competition: By giving patients a range of options for healthcare services through the healthcare marketplace, providers are forced to compete on price, quality, and service. This competition can lead to better outcomes for patients, as providers are incentivized to provide high-quality care at a reasonable cost.

Better access to care: By giving patients a range of options for healthcare services, they can choose a provider that is convenient and accessible for them. This can be especially beneficial for patients in rural areas, where access to healthcare services may be limited.

Improved transparency: Patients are given more information about the services they are receiving, including the cost and quality of care. This can help patients make more informed decisions about their healthcare, and can also help to reduce costs by promoting price transparency.

Increased efficiency: By giving patients a range of options for telehealth marketplace  services, providers are forced to be more efficient and to find ways to reduce costs. This can lead to lower healthcare costs overall, as well as improved outcomes for patients.

Improved patient experience: Patients are given more control over their healthcare, and they can choose a provider that meets their needs and preferences. This can lead to a more personalized healthcare experience, which can be especially beneficial for patients with complex healthcare needs.
